Techno-productive experiences for climate action in Argentina: Insights from renewable energy projects
The main purpose of this research is to analyze techno-productive experiences within the framework of renewable energy projects based on the use and exploitation of solar energy in a region defined by favorable bioclimatic conditions. Following a primarily qualitative method, the research has been based on four case studies of working groups and their experiences. Stakeholders from diverse origin and background, interested in developing their technologies (processes, inputs, components, equipment) for the use of solar energy have managed to enhance the links among such developments, the productive sector and the communities in the territorial area where they carry out their activities. As a possible path of sociotechnical transition, these specific processes materialize energy transition with the progressive change of production and consumption patterns in favor of climate action.
